Former Blue Jays All-Star Getting MLB Interest Amid Overseas Stint

Former Toronto Blue Jays All-Star Aaron Sanchez is making a comeback in the MLB after a successful stint overseas this winter. The right-handed pitcher has caught the attention of several teams with his impressive performance, and it seems like he is ready to make a strong comeback in the upcoming season.

Sanchez, who was once a key player for the Blue Jays, had a rough couple of years due to injuries. However, he refused to let these setbacks define his career and decided to take his talents overseas to play in the Dominican Winter League. This decision turned out to be a game-changer for the 28-year-old pitcher.

Sanchez joined the Gigantes del Cibao team in the Dominican Republic and quickly made an impact. In his first start, he threw five scoreless innings, allowing only two hits and striking out six batters. This impressive performance caught the attention of many MLB teams, who were closely monitoring his progress.

The Gigantes del Cibao manager, Pedro Lopez, praised Sanchez for his dedication and hard work. He said, “Aaron has been a great addition to our team. He came in with a positive attitude and has been working hard to improve his game. His performance on the field speaks for itself, and I am not surprised that he is gaining interest from MLB teams.”

Sanchez continued to impress in his next few starts, consistently throwing strikes and showcasing his powerful fastball. He finished the winter league with a 2.95 ERA and 21 strikeouts in 18.1 innings pitched. This performance has reignited the interest of many MLB teams in Sanchez, who is now a free agent.

The Blue Jays, who released Sanchez in 2019, are also reportedly interested in bringing him back to the team. General Manager Ross Atkins stated, “We have been keeping a close eye on Aaron’s progress in the Dominican Winter League. He has shown great improvement and is definitely on our radar.”

Sanchez’s agent, Scott Boras, has also confirmed that there is a lot of interest in his client from various teams. He said, “Aaron has been receiving a lot of attention from MLB teams, and we are currently in talks with several of them. He is determined to make a strong comeback and is looking forward to the upcoming season.”
